The Unexpected Costs

Winning a house doesn't mean you get it for free. Oh no. Uncle Sam wants his cut! We're talking about taxes. Huge taxes. Winning a house, depending on its value, can push you into a higher tax bracket. Suddenly, you owe a significant chunk of change just for accepting the prize.

Then there's the upkeep. Property taxes, insurance, utilities… these things don't magically disappear just because you won the house. Can you afford to maintain this newfound asset? It's a question many winners don't consider until it's too late.
